Report: Mexico sack Victor Manuel Vucetich

Mexico will reportedly confirm the sacking of Victor Manuel Vucetich later on today and announce America coach Miguel Herrera as his replacement.

Mexico have reportedly sacked Victor Manuel Vucetich less than six weeks after hiring him as manager.

According to the Televisa network, which owns Mexican club America, their coach Miguel Herrera has been named as his replacement ahead of next month's World Cup qualifier against New Zealand.

The Mexican Football Federation are expected to confirm the decision later today.

"The turbulence of the Mexican national team will take new victims and Miguel Herrera will step in," read a statement on their website.

"Victor Manuel Vucetich will cease to be the national team coach and Miguel Herrera will take command to face the playoff against New Zealand."

The 58-year-old oversaw a win against Panama and a defeat to Costa Rica in his two games after taking over from Jose Manuel de la Torre.
